It is a faux Aussie accent I think and was catching a few years ago it has died out a bit now.

The technical name for it is the High rising terminal (confusingly abbreviated to HRT - make your own jokes). Though the Wiki doesn't comment on its decline in the UK over the last decade or so, you certainly do hear it a lot less, as you say.  It may partly be the fading away of the Australian soaps, but also the way this linguistic feature came to be seen as less prestigious.
